A股“上半场”收官,3700多只个股上涨
Core Viewpoint - The A-share market demonstrated strong resilience in the first half of the year, with major indices showing an upward trend despite external uncertainties, leading to optimistic expectations for the second half of the year [1][3]. Market Performance - On June 30, the A-share market closed with all three major indices rising: the Shanghai Composite Index at 3444.43 points, up 0.59%, the Shenzhen Component Index up 0.83%, and the ChiNext Index up 1.35%. A total of 4056 stocks in the market were in the green [3]. - The Shanghai Composite Index recorded a cumulative increase of 2.76% in the first half of the year, while the Shenzhen Component Index and ChiNext Index saw increases of 0.49% and 0.53%, respectively. The STAR 50 Index rose by 9.93%, and the North Exchange's North 50 Index surged by 39.45% [3][4]. Sector Performance - The military, semiconductor, and photolithography sectors led the market, while previously strong sectors like banking, brokerage, and oil and gas showed weakness [3]. - Over 3700 stocks increased in value during the first half, with more than 100 stocks rising over 100%. Notably, nearly 20 bank stocks reached historical highs [4]. Market Dynamics - The A-share market's total market capitalization surpassed 100 trillion yuan, marking a historic milestone [5]. - The market experienced structural differentiation, with technology stocks and small-cap stocks outperforming the market, while high-dividend sectors like non-ferrous metals and banking also performed well [7]. Future Outlook - Analysts predict that the A-share market will face significant tests from earnings, trade, and policy variables in the second half, with increased volatility but also potential structural opportunities [10]. - Institutions expect that sectors with strong and certain mid-year earnings, such as wind power, gaming, pets, small metals, rare earths, and brokerages, will be key areas of focus [11].

A股半年收官 北证50指数半年涨近40% DeepSeek概念及兵装重组概念上半年领涨
Xin Hua Cai Jing· 2025-06-30 07:43
Market Performance - The major stock indices in Shanghai and Shenzhen opened mixed on the 30th, with the Shanghai Composite Index slightly lower and the Shenzhen Component and ChiNext indices higher [1] - By the end of the trading day, the Shanghai Composite Index closed at 3444.43 points, up 0.59%, with a trading volume of approximately 567.1 billion [1] - The Shenzhen Component Index closed at 10465.12 points, up 0.83%, with a trading volume of approximately 919.7 billion [1] - The ChiNext Index closed at 2153.01 points, up 1.35%, with a trading volume of approximately 462.2 billion [1] - The STAR Market Index closed at 1229.83 points, up 1.70%, with a trading volume of approximately 112.8 billion [1] - The North Star 50 Index closed at 1447.18 points, up 0.52%, with a trading volume of approximately 30.7 billion [1] Sector Performance - The military industry stocks continued their strong performance, with the sector index rising for six consecutive trading days [1] - The brain-computer interface sector opened significantly higher and saw a steady rise during the morning session [1] - Gaming stocks experienced volatility but maintained high levels during the trading day [1] - Other sectors such as photolithography machines, large aircraft, BC batteries, commercial aerospace, cultivated diamonds, exoskeleton robots, and electronic IDs also saw significant increases [1] - Financial stocks, including banks and securities, experienced slight declines, but the overall drop was minimal [1] Half-Year Performance - The Shanghai Composite Index rose 2.76% in the first half of the year, while the Shenzhen Component Index increased by 0.49% [2] - The ChiNext Index and STAR Market Index both saw gains of 0.53% and 9.93%, respectively, in the same period [2] - The North Star 50 Index had a remarkable increase of 39.45% in the first half of the year [2] - Sectors such as DeepSeek concept, military equipment restructuring, precious metals, controllable nuclear fusion, agricultural machinery, humanoid robots, Xiaohongshu concept, brain-computer interface, AI agents, and rare earth permanent magnets showed strong performance year-to-date [2] Institutional Insights - Market volatility is expected to increase in July due to upcoming earnings, trade, and policy changes, presenting structural investment opportunities [3] - Investors are advised to focus on sectors with high earnings certainty, such as semiconductor equipment and photovoltaic components, while also considering sectors that may benefit from policy support [3] - The market sentiment is anticipated to continue improving, supported by domestic policy measures aimed at addressing economic downturns [3] - The valuation of A-shares remains attractive for medium to long-term investments, with the current equity risk premium index indicating a favorable position [3] Fundraising Trends - The issuance of stock-based funds has reached a near four-year high in the first half of the year, with 663 new funds established, totaling 526.768 billion shares [5] - The proportion of stock-based funds in total fund issuance has increased from 21.14% to 35.35% this year, while the share of bond funds has decreased significantly [5] Futures Industry Performance - In May, futures companies achieved a net profit of 820 million, representing a year-on-year increase of 19.88% [6] - The total operating income for futures companies in May was 3.172 billion, up 2.03% year-on-year [6] - For the first five months of 2025, futures companies reported cumulative operating income of 15.247 billion, a 5.40% increase year-on-year, and a net profit of 4.084 billion, up 34.56% [6]
